Abstract
STUDY DESIGN Retrospective cohort study. OBJECTIVE The aim of this study was to compare the relative value units (RVUs) and 30-day outcomes between primary and revision pediatric spinal deformity (PSD) surgery. SUMMARY OF BACKGROUND DATA PSD surgery is frequently complicated by the need for reoperation. However, there is limited literature on physician reimbursement rates and short-term outcomes following primary versus revision spinal deformity surgery in the pediatric population. MATERIALS AND METHODS This study utilizes data obtained from the American College of Surgeons National Surgical Quality Improvement Program (ACS-NSQIP) Pediatric database. Patients between 10 and 18 years of age who underwent posterior spinal deformity surgery between 2012 and 2018 were included. Univariate and multivariate regression were used to assess the independent impact of revision surgery on RVUs and postoperative outcomes, including 30-day readmission, reoperation, morbidity, and complications. RESULTS The study cohort included a total of 15,055 patients, with 358 patients who underwent revision surgery. Patients in the revision group were more likely to be younger and male sex. Revision surgery more commonly required osteotomy (13.7% vs. 8.3%, P =0.002).Univariate analysis revealed higher total RVUs (71.09 vs. 60.51, P <0.001), RVUs per minute (0.27 vs. 0.23, P <0.001), readmission rate (6.7% vs. 4.0%, P =0.012), and reoperation rate (7.5% vs. 3.3%, P <0.001) for the revision surgery group. Morbidity rates were found to be statistically similar. In addition, deep surgical site infection, pulmonary embolism, and urinary tract infection were more common in the revision group. After controlling for baseline differences in multivariate regression, the differences in total RVUs, RVUs per minute, reoperation rate, and rate of pulmonary embolism between primary and revision surgery remained statistically significant. CONCLUSIONS Revision PSD surgery was found to be assigned appropriately higher mean total RVUs and RVUs per minute corresponding to the higher operative complexity compared with primary surgery. Revision surgery was also associated with poorer 30-day outcomes, including higher frequencies of reoperation and pulmonary embolism. LEVEL OF EVIDENCE Level III.

Abstract
Inferior vena cava filters are indicated for the prevention of pulmonary embolism when anticoagulation using heparin has failed or is contraindicated. The aim of this study was to assess in an in-vitro setting the efficiency of a new inferior vena cava filter to intercept emboli. The new filter, stent-filter, was inserted into a pulsating flow circuit. Then thrombi were produced by introducing sheep's blood into silicon tubes with 3 mm diameter. A combination of 9% saline solution with 40% glycerol was used as the isosmotic fluid in the circuit. A total of 150 thrombi were introduced into the circuit in 3 stages of 50 events each. The flow rate in each of the 3 stages was altered; initially a rate of 1.0 liter per minute was chosen, and after this, it was increased to 1.5 liters and finally 2.0 liters per minute. The percentage of interceptions was used for statistical analysis. In the in-vitro experiment, the filter captured 94%, 90%, and 92% of the thrombi at flow rates of 1.0, 1.5, and 2.0 liters per second, respectively. In conclusion the new filter was effective in the interception of the thrombi when it was evaluated in in-vitro conditions.

Abstract
The aim of this study was to evaluate the association between ischemic childhood stroke and thrombophilia. The prevalence of thrombophilia risk factors in 30 unrelated children with ischemic stroke were compared with 33 age-matched control subjects. Patients and control group were tested for the presence of activated protein C (APC) resistance, antiphospholipid antibodies (APLA), increased factor VIII levels, and for the deficiency of protein C (PC), protein S (PS), and antithrombin. When APCR was detected in patients or in controls, factor V Leiden (FVL) mutation was also tested. Seventeen of 30 patients (56.6%) had at least one thrombophilia marker compared with only 5 of 33 control subjects (15.1%). Three children with ischemic stroke (10%) were affected with a combination of two or more thrombophilia markers whereas none of the children in the control group had a combination of risk factors. Seven of 30 children with ischemic stroke (23.3%) and one of 33 control subjects (3.03%) had APC resistance and in all of them FVL mutation were found. The prevalence of FVL mutation was higher among pediatric stroke patients than among control subjects (p < 0.05). None of the patients but one child from the control group (3.03%) had PS deficiency. Antithrombin and PC deficiencies and the presence of APLA and increased factor VIII levels were more frequent in the pediatric stroke patients than in controls but the difference was not statistically significant (p > 0.05). These data confirm that stroke in children is commonly associated with a combination of multiple risk factors and especially the prevalence of FVL mutation is increased in children with ischemic stroke compared with control subjects.

Abstract
Venous thromboembolism (VTE) is a common condition that increases in incidence with age and risk factors. Therapies for VTE are aimed at either preventing the disease in high-risk individuals or treating patients who have developed VTE. Assessing risk and aggressively using the recommended therapies is primacy in preventing VTE in surgical and medical patients. Risk of VTE in medical patients has become more defined in recent years, and prophylaxis in this group can prevent scores of iatrogenic VTE. Treatment of VTE has evolved in the past decade from a condition that required hospitalization for 5 to 7 days to a disease state that can be conveniently and safely treated on an outpatient basis, largely due to the advent of low-molecular-weight heparins and patient self-directed treatment.

Abstract
Idiopathic systemic capillary leak syndrome (ISCLS) is a rare condition that is characterized by unexplained episodic capillary hyperpermeability due to a shift of fluid and protein from the intravascular to the interstitial space. This results in diffuse general swelling, fetal hypovolemic shock, hypoalbuminemia, and hemoconcentration. Although ISCLS rarely induces cerebral infarction, we experienced a patient who deteriorated and was comatose as a result of massive cerebral infarction associated with ISCLS. In this case, severe hypotensive shock, general edema, hemiparesis, and aphasia appeared after serious antecedent gastrointestinal symptoms. Progressive life-threatening ischemic cerebral edema required decompressive hemicraniectomy. The patient experienced another episode of severe hypotension and limb edema that resulted in multiple extremity compartment syndrome. Treatment entailed forearm and calf fasciotomies. Cerebral edema in the ischemic brain progresses rapidly in patients suffering from ISCLS. Strict control of fluid volume resuscitation and aggressive diuretic therapy may be needed during the post-leak phase of fluid remobilization.

Abstract
CONTEXT Factor V Leiden mutation is the most common inherited predisposition for hypercoagulability and thereby a common genetic cause for initiation of oral anti-coagulation therapy. There is a dearth of knowledge of coumarin response profile in such thrombophilic population. AIMS The current pilot study aims to estimate coumarin sensitivity in an Indian cohort with an inherited thrombophilia risk factor (Factor V Leiden mutation carriers) based on the observed frequency of CYP2C9 (*)2, (*)3 and VKORC1-1639G >A genotype combinations. SETTINGS AND DESIGN A retrospective study carried out in a tertiary health care center in India. MATERIALS AND METHODS Carriers of FVL mutation were genotyped for CYP2C9 ((*)2, F(*)3) and VKORC1 (-1639G >A) variants by PCR-RFLP technique. STATISTICAL ANALYSIS USED Chi-square test to analyze difference in expected and observed genotype frequency. RESULTS Sixty-one (n = 61) unrelated carriers of FVL mutation were observed in the 13 years study period. The allele frequency of CYP2C9 (*)2, CYP2C9 (*)3, and VKORC1-1639A in this cohort was 0.06, 0.11, and 0.16, respectively. Six (9.7%) individuals had two of the three variant alleles (heterozygous or homozygous), and 28 (45.9%) were heterozygous for at least one polymorphism. CONCLUSIONS Pre-prescription genotyping for coumarin drugs, if introduced in Indians with inherited thrombophilia (in whom oral anti-coagulant therapy may be necessary), is likely to identify 9.7% (hypersensitive) subjects in whom the optimum anti-coagulation may be achieved with reduced dosages, 44.3% (normal sensitivity) who may require higher dose and also 55.6% (hyper and moderate sensitivity) subjects who are likely to experience bleeding episodes.

Abstract
It is generally accepted that the major autoantigen for antiphospholipid antibodies (aPL) in the antiphospholipid syndrome (APS) is beta(2)-glycoprotein I (beta(2)GPI). However, a recent study has revealed that some aPL bind to certain conformational epitope(s) on beta(2)GPI shared by the homologous enzymatic domains of several serine proteases involved in hemostasis and fibrinolysis. Importantly, some serine protease-reactive aPL correspondingly hinder anticoagulant regulation and resolution of clots. These results extend several early findings of aPL binding to other coagulation factors and provide a new perspective about some aPL in terms of binding specificities and related functional properties in promoting thrombosis. Moreover, a recent immunological and pathological study of a panel of human IgG monoclonal aPL showed that aPL with strong binding to thrombin promote in vivo venous thrombosis and leukocyte adherence, suggesting that aPL reactivity with thrombin may be a good predictor for pathogenic potentials of aPL.

Abstract
Progressive postinjury coagulopathy remains the fundamental rationale for damage control surgery, but the decision to abort operative intervention must occur before laboratory confirmation of coagulopathy. Current massive transfusion protocols have embraced pre-emptive resuscitation strategies emphasizing administration of packed red blood cells, fresh frozen plasma, and platelets in ratios approximating 1:1:1 during the first 24 hours postinjury, based on US military retrospective experience and recent noncontrolled civilian data. This policy, termed "damage control resuscitation" assumes that patients presenting with life threatening hemorrhage at risk for postinjury coagulopathy should receive component therapy in rations approximating those found in whole blood during the first 24 hours. While we concur with the concept of pre-emptive coagulation factor replacement, and initially suggested this in 1982, we remain concerned for the continued unbridled administration of fresh frozen plasma and platelets without objective evidence of their specific requirement. A major limitation of current massive transfusion protocols is the lack of real time assessment of coagulation function to guide evolving blood component requirements. Existing laboratory coagulation testing was originally designed for evaluation of hemophilia and subsequently used for monitoring anticoagulation therapy. Consequently, the applicability of these tests in the trauma setting has never been proven and the time required to conduct these assays is incompatible with prompt correction of the coagulopathy in the trauma setting. This review examines the current approach to postinjury coagulopathy, including identification of patients at risk, resuscitation strategies, design and implementation of institutional massive transfusion protocols, and the potential benefits of goal-directed therapy by real time assessment of coagulation function via point of care rapid thromboelastography.

Abstract
BACKGROUND Despite routine prophylaxis, thromboembolic events (TEs) in surgical patients remain a substantial problem. Furthermore, the timing and incidence of hypercoagulability, which predisposes to these events is unknown, with institutional screening programs serving primarily to establish a diagnosis after an event has occurred. Emerging evidence suggests that point of care (POC) rapid thrombelastography (r-TEG) provides a real-time analysis of comprehensive thrombostatic function, which represents an analysis of both enzymatic and platelet components of thrombus formation. We hypothesized that r-TEG can be used as a screening tool to identify hypercoagulable states in surgical patients and would predict subsequent thromboembolic events. METHODS Rapid thrombelastography r-TEG analyses were performed on 152 critically ill patients in the surgical intensive care unit (ICU) during 7 months. Hypercoagulability was defined as clot strength (G)>12.4 dynes/cm(2). Variables of interest for identifying hypercoagulability and thromboembolic events included sex, age, operating hospital service, specific injury patterns, injury severity score (ISS), transfusion within first 24 h, ICU duration of stay, ventilator days, hospital admission days, and thromboprophylaxis. Comparisons between the hypercoagulable and normal groups or between the groups with and without thromboembolic events were performed using Chi-square tests or the Fisher exact test for categorical variables and independent sample t tests or Wilcoxon rank sum tests for continuous variables. Multivariate logistic regression analysis (LR) was performed to identify independent predictors of thromboembolic events. A receiver operating characteristic curve was used to measure the performance of G for predicting the occurrence of a TE event. All tests were 2-sided with significance of P < .05. RESULTS In all, 86 patients (67%) were hypercoagulable by r-TEG. More than 85% of patients in the hypercoagulable group and 79% in the normal group received thromboprophylaxis during the study period. The differences between hypercoagulable and normal groups by bivariate analysis included high-risk injuries (52% vs 35%; P = .03), spinal cord injury (27% vs 12%; P = .03), median ICU duration of stay (13 vs 7 days; P < .001), median ventilator days (6 vs 2; P < .001), and median hospital duration of stay (20 vs 13 days; P < .001). A total of 16 patients (19%) of the hypercoagulable group suffered a thromboembolic event, and 10 hypercoagulable patients (12%) had thromboembolic events predicted by prior r-TEG hypercoagulability. No patients with normal coagulability by r-TEG had an event (P < .001). LR analysis showed that the strongest predictor of TE after controlling for the presence of thromboprophylaxis was elevated G value (odds ratio: 1.25, 95% confidence interval [CI]: 1.12-1.39). For every 1 dyne/cm(2) increase in G, the odds of a TE increased by 25%. CONCLUSION These results indicate that the presence of hypercoagulability identified by r-TEG is predictive of thromboembolic events in surgical patients. Subsequent study is necessary to define optimal prophylactic treatment strategies for patients with r-TEG proven hypercoagulability.

Abstract
We previously reported that some human antiphospholipid Abs (aPL) in patients with the antiphospholipid syndrome (APS) bind to the homologous enzymatic domains of thrombin and the activated coagulation factor X (FXa). Moreover, some of the reactive Abs are prothrombotic and interfere with inactivation of thrombin and FXa by antithrombin (AT). Considering the enzymatic domain of activated coagulation factor IX (FIXa) is homologous to those of thrombin and FXa, we hypothesized that some aPLs in APS bind to FIXa and hinder AT inactivation of FIXa. To test this hypothesis, we searched for IgG anti-FIXa Abs in APS patients. Once the concerned Abs were found, we studied the effects of the Ab on FIXa inactivation by AT. We found that 10 of 12 patient-derived monoclonal IgG aPLs bound to FIXa and that IgG anti-FIXa Abs in APS patients were significantly higher than those in normal controls (p < 0.0001). Using the mean + 3 SD of 30 normal controls as the cutoff, the IgG anti-FIXa Abs were present in 11 of 38 (28.9%) APS patients. Importantly, 4 of 10 FIXa-reactive monoclonal aPLs (including the B2 mAb generated against beta(2)-glycoprotein I significantly hindered AT inactivation of FIXa. More importantly, IgG from two positive plasma samples were found to interfere with AT inactivation of FIXa. In conclusion, IgG anti-FIXa Ab occurred in approximately 30% of APS patients and could interfere with AT inactivation of FIXa. Because FIXa is an upstream procoagulant factor, impaired AT regulation of FIXa might contribute more toward thrombosis than the dysregulation of the downstream FXa and thrombin.

Abstract
BACKGROUND Venous thromboembolism (VTE) is a recognized cause of morbidity and mortality in hospitalized patients and is reported to account for 250,000 deaths annually. Recent shifts in prophylaxis administration are occurring among surgical specialty groups after observing a lower rate of VTE among patients undergoing elective operation. We report the incidence of VTE from 3 sources to provide an estimate of the true risk of the complication in elective surgery. METHODS Data from the Surgical Care Improvement Project (SCIP), University HealthSystem Consortium (UHC), and Kentucky Cabinet for Health and Family Services (CHFS) databases were queried for 2004 for the same operative patient groups. RESULTS Of 5,285 operations performed within SCIP 2004, the incidences of deep venous thrombosis (DVT) and pulmonary embolus (PE) were 0.4% and 0.3%, respectively, with no reported deaths. Of 966,474 operations recorded in the UHC 2004 data, rates of DVT and PE were 1.2% and 0.5%, respectively. The incidence rates of DVT and PE among 20,563 patients in the CHFS 2004 database were 0.5% and 0.3%, respectively, and included 3 deaths. CONCLUSION VTE and associated mortality rates are extremely low in these 3 large data sources. We believe patients will benefit from an ongoing assessment of real need and complications of carefully risk-adjusted VTE prophylaxis.

Abstract
STUDY DESIGN Retrospective review. OBJECTIVE To determine the incidence and identify the associated risk factors of pulmonary embolism (PE) in patients who receive pharmacologic thromboprophylaxis after adult spinal deformity surgery. SUMMARY OF BACKGROUND DATA The risk of PE after adult spinal deformity surgery is reported to be as high as 2.2%. However, the incidence and associated risks of PE in the same patient population who receive postoperative pharmacologic thromboprophylaxis is unknown. METHODS The study included 361 adult patients with spinal deformity who underwent 407 corrective spinal procedures for scoliosis, kyphosis, or kyphoscoliosis. The incidence of PE was determined and compared with a study (historical control) of similar patients undergoing similar surgery but without postoperative pharmacologic thromboprophylaxis. Their demographic information, American Society of Anesthesiologists score, operative time, surgical approach, surgical complexity, and intraoperative blood loss were also analyzed to determine the presence of associated risk factors. RESULTS Despite universal pharmacologic thromboprophylaxis, 10 pulmonary emboli (2.4%) were diagnosed. Patients undergoing anterior spinal surgery were at a significantly higher risk than those undergoing posterior spinal surgery (P = 0.024). The right-side anterior approach was also associated with a significantly higher incidence of PE compared with the left-sided anterior approach (P = 0.018). Although the rate of PE after posterior spinal surgery did not differ from the historical control, the rate of PE after anterior surgery was reduced by 50% compared with the historical control. Age, gender, estimated blood loss, operative time, revision status, and the number of fusion levels were not significant variables for PE. There were 2 epidural hematomas requiring decompression (0.48%) and 1 wound hematoma (0.24%). CONCLUSION Although pharmacologic thromboprophylaxis probably does not have a role after posterior spinal surgery, the data in this study suggest that it does lower the incidence of PE after anterior spinal surgery.

Abstract
AbstractThe antithrombin A384S mutation has a relatively high frequency in the British population but has not been identified in other populations. This variant has been associated with cases of thrombotic disease, but its clinical relevance in venous thrombosis remained unclear. We have conducted a secondary analysis of the prevalence of the mutation in a large case-control study, including 1018 consecutive Spanish patients with venous thromboembolism. In addition, we evaluated its functional consequences in 20 carriers (4 homozygous). This mutation, even in the homozygous state, did not affect anti-Xa activity or antigen levels, and it only slightly impaired anti-IIa activity. Thus, routine clinical methods cannot detect this anomaly, and, accordingly, this alteration could have been underestimated. We identified this mutation in 0.2% of Spanish controls. Among patients, this variant represented the first cause of antithrombin anomalies. Indeed, 1.7% patients carried the A384S mutation, but 0.6% had any other antithrombin deficiency. The mutated allele was associated with an increased risk of venous thrombosis with an adjusted OR of 9.75 (95% CI, 2.2-42.5). This is the first study supporting that antithrombin A384S mutation is a prevalent genetic risk factor for venous thrombosis and is the most frequent cause of antithrombin deficiency in white populations.

Abstract
PURPOSE To report an ex vivo study on the local effects of hydrodynamic thrombectomy for the treatment of acute pulmonary embolism (off-label use). METHODS Three devices (6-F AngioJet Xpeedior and 6-F and 8-F Oasis) were used for hydrodynamic thrombectomy inside the arteries of 24 inflated and perfused porcine lung explants. Each system was used at multiple positions inside 4 intact and 4 embolized lungs in vessels measuring 2 to 4 mm, 4 to 6 mm, 6 to 8 mm, and 8 to 10 mm. Angiograms prior to, during, and after catheter positioning and system operation were used to detect arterial wall trauma and to measure local clot removal per 30-second cycle. A total of 21 vessel wall samples were subjected to scanning electron microscopy (SEM) to evaluate non-perforating lesions. RESULTS All systems were able to remove clot material. The average recanalized vessel length normalized to 30 seconds for vessel diameters of 2 to 4 and 8 to 10 mm, respectively, was 1.17 and 1.75 cm (AngioJet), 0.97 and 0.25 cm (6-F Oasis), and 2.2 and 1.05 cm (8-F Oasis). Perforations occurred during positioning of the 6-F Oasis (4/78 maneuvers) and 8-F Oasis (13/60), but not the AngioJet (0/89); perforations were also seen during system operation (AngioJet: 21/89 activations, 6-F Oasis: 4/78, and 8-F Oasis: 9/60; all lesions inside vessels <6 mm in diameter). SEM showed 35 lesions, 14 with perforation (contrast extravasation) and 21 without perforation (induced by the tip of the guidewire). CONCLUSION The AngioJet was most efficient in clot removal, followed by the 8-F Oasis. The 6-F Oasis was least efficient, but had fewest complications. According to these experiments, the tested hydrodynamic thrombectomy devices may cause perforations in vessels <6 mm in diameter. Changes in catheter design to reduce system-specific complication rates or to improve the efficacy of clot removal are warranted.

Abstract
Our objective was to characterize the etiologic factors and outcome for stroke in children. We retrospectively reviewed the charts of patients between the ages of 40 days and 94 months (36.5 +/- 23.7 months) with stroke seen at Istanbul Medical Faculty, Department of Pediatrics between January 1995 and December 2003. We found 79 cases of stroke: 57 ischemic and 22 hemorrhagic strokes. Seventeen children had vitamin K deficiency dependent hemorrhage. In 14 children stroke occurred as a complication of cardiac disease, 7 had moyamoya disease, 3 had protein C deficiency, 2 had thalassemia, 2 had hyperhomocysteinemia (methylene tetrahydrofolate reductase gene mutation), 2 were heterozygote for factor V Leiden, 3 had Down's syndrome, 1 was diagnosed with antiphospholipid syndrome, 1 had glycogen storage disease, and in 28 children no underlying cause could be found. Multiple risk factors were found in 4 children. The outcome in all 79 stroke patients was as follows: asymptomatic 60%; symptomatic epilepsy or persistent neurologic deficit 37%; death 3%; and recurrent stroke 5%. Thus, an underlying cause for stroke was identified in 65% of the children in the study group; 40% of the children either died or suffered motor and/or cognitive sequelae.

Abstract
Postoperative thrombotic complications increase hospital length of stay and health care costs. Given the potential for thrombotic complications to result from hypercoagulable states, we sought to determine whether postoperative blood analysis using thromboelastography could predict the occurrence of thrombotic complications, including myocardial infarction (MI). We prospectively enrolled 240 patients undergoing a wide variety of surgical procedures. A cardiac risk score was assigned to each patient using the established revised Goldman risk index. Thromboelastography was performed immediately after surgery and maximum amplitude (MA), representing clot strength, was determined. Postoperative thrombotic complications requiring confirmation by a diagnostic test were assessed by a blinded observer. Ten patients (4.2%) suffered a total of 12 postoperative thrombotic complications. The incidence of thrombotic complications with increased MA (8 of 95 = 8.4%) was significantly (P = 0.0157) more frequent than that of patients with MA < or =68 (2 of 145 = 1.4%). Furthermore, the percentage suffering postoperative MI in the increased MA group (6 of 95 = 6.3%) was significantly larger than that in the MA < or =68 group (0 of 145 = 0%) (P = 0.0035). In a multivariate analysis, increased MA (P = 0.013; odds ratio, 1.16; 95% confidence interval, 1.03-1.20) and Goldman risk score (P = 0.046; odds ratio, 2.39; 95% confidence interval, 1.02-5.61) both independently predicted postoperative MI. A postoperative hypercoagulable state as determined by thromboelastography is associated with postoperative thrombotic complications, including MI, in a diverse group of surgical patients.

Abstract
Venous thromboembolism (VTE) is common but often unrecognized in medically ill patients. Over the past 5 years, three large-scale placebo-controlled trials enrolling a total of 5500 medically ill patients have highlighted the risk of VTE in this group. These trials have helped to define a specific at-risk patient profile, including those admitted to the hospital with severe congestive heart failure, respiratory illness, acute infection, and inflammatory bowel disease. We performed a retrospective review of patients admitted to the medical service at our tertiary care center to define how common the at-risk medical patient is and to evaluate and improve prophylaxis rates in this patient group. The study was conducted in two phases. Based on admission characteristics, patients were stratified into high-risk or low-risk groups for the development of VTE. During the pre-intervention phase, 75% of patients admitted to the medical service were characterized as increased risk for VTE, yet only 43% of these high-risk patients received prophylaxis of any sort. After interventions designed to increase awareness of VTE, we conducted a second review period. In this post-intervention phase, where 79% of patients were at risk for VTE, prophylaxis rates improved to 72%. Based on these results, we conclude that the majority of patients admitted to the medical service at our tertiary care center constitute a high-risk population that warrants consideration for VTE prophylaxis. Implementation of strategies to improve prophylaxis rates, including educational sessions and risk stratification guidelines, can be successful and improve identification and prophylaxis of this population.

Abstract
Antithrombin deficiency is a hypercoagulable state that can increase the risk for thrombosis, especially in the presence of other procoagulant triggers. Unfractionated heparin and low-molecular-weight heparins may not provide effective anticoagulation since they require antithrombin for activity. Direct thrombin inhibitors, however, work independently of antithrombin. A 21-year-old man with a history of heavy alcohol consumption had thrombosis of the superior mesenteric vein. Infusion with unfractionated heparin was started, and despite repeated boluses and increases to 21 U/kg/hour, the maximum activated partial thromboplastin time reached was 39 seconds. The unfractionated heparin was discontinued, and the direct thrombin inhibitor argatroban was infused at rates of 0.4-0.5 microg/kg/minute. Over the course of several weeks, the patient had numerous operations to remove and repair necrotic bowel. When no further surgery was anticipated, warfarin therapy was started; the argatroban infusion was discontinued when the patient reached the therapeutic target international normalized ratio with warfarin. No recurrent thrombosis or major bleeding occurred. Direct thrombin inhibitors, such as argatroban, seem to be suitable alternatives for acute anticoagulation in patients with antithrombin deficiency.

Abstract
PURPOSE To use porcine lung explants for reconstructing possible situations in which a vessel wall disruption might have occurred in a patient suffering fatal hemoptysis after pulmonary embolectomy with a hydrodynamic thrombectomy device. METHODS A 76-year-old woman with massive pulmonary embolism underwent transvenous pulmonary embolectomy using a 6-F AngioJet Xpeedior catheter according to manufacturer's instructions. While activating the device in the middle lobe artery (approximately 8 mm diameter), massive and ultimately fatal arterial bleeding occurred through the tracheal tube. Because no autopsy was authorized, an experimental study was designed to examine possible causes for the vessel disruption. Five fresh porcine heart-lung preparations were examined inside a dedicated chest phantom. Access to the pulmonary vessels was provided through catheters inside the right and left ventricular outlets. A low-flow circulation was maintained with an external pump. The 6-F AngioJet thrombectomy device was activated at 42 sites inside vessels from 2 to 10 mm in diameter; in one lung, 8 activations were made after deliberately withdrawing the guidewire. RESULTS Vessels >6 mm in diameter remained intact. Vessel wall disruption occurred in 4 of 7 vessels between 4 and 6 mm in diameter and in 13 of 14 segmental arteries <4 mm in diameter (regardless of whether or not a guidewire was used). The signs of vessel wall disruption included extravasation of contrast material, arteriovenous fistula, and laceration of distal airspaces with contrast inside the bronchus. CONCLUSIONS The application of this system has to be considered potentially dangerous when activated inside vessels with diameters <6 mm. The use of this device appears to be safe only inside main branches of the lung vessels at this time. Additional experiments will be required to substantiate these initial results.

Abstract
Antiphospholipid antibodies are associated strongly with thrombosis and are the most common of the acquired blood protein defects causing thrombosis. Although the precise mechanisms whereby antiphospholipid antibodies alter hemostasis to induce a hypercoagulable state remain unclear, numerous theories, as previously discussed, have been advanced. The most common thrombotic events associated with ACLAs are deep vein thrombosis and pulmonary embolus (type I syndrome), coronary or peripheral artery thrombosis (type II syndrome), or cerebrovascular/retinal vessel thrombosis (type III syndrome), and occasionally patients present with mixtures (type IV syndrome). Patients with type V disease are those with antiphospholipid antibodies and RMS. It is as yet unclear how many seemingly normal individuals who may never develop manifestations of antiphospholipid syndrome (type VI) harbor asymptomatic antiphospholipid antibodies. The relative frequency of ACLAs in association with arterial and venous thrombosis strongly suggests that they should be looked for in any individual with unexplained thrombosis; all three idiotypes (IgG, IgA, and IgM) should be assessed. Also, the type of syndrome (I-VI) should be defined, if possible, because this identification may dictate both the type and the duration of immediate and long-term anticoagulant therapy. Unlike those patients with ACLAs, patients with primary LA-thrombosis syndrome usually have venous thrombosis. Because the aPTT is unreliable in patients with LA (prolonged in only approximately 40%-50% of patients) and usually is not prolonged in patients with ACLAs, definitive tests, including ELISA for ACLA, the dilute Russell's viper venom time for LA, hexagonal phospholipid-neutralization procedure, and B-2-GP-I (IgG, IgA, and IgM) should be ordered immediately when suspecting antiphospholipid syndrome or in individuals with otherwise unexplained thrombotic or thromboembolic events. If these test results are negative, subgroups also should be assessedin the appropriate clinical setting. Most patients with antiphospholipid thrombosis syndrome will fail to respond to warfarin therapy, and except for retinal vascular thrombosis, may fail some types of antiplatelet therapy, so it is of major importance to make this diagnosis so patients can be treated with the most effective therapy for secondary prevention-LMWH or unfractionated heparin in most instances and clopidogrel in some instances.
